How Jasmine Ice Batches Are Checked

Most defects in jasmine ice are not dramatic. They are loose tolerances, a slightly thin seal, a mouthpiece that clicks. Left alone they turn into leak complaints, which are the single most common reason a retailer drops a line.

Inspection is only useful if the result is recorded somewhere you can find it later. A jasmine ice batch log with weights, codes and measurements turns a future complaint into a five minute lookup.

What if a batch does not match the sample?

Keep the retained samples from the approval stage. If a delivered batch measurably differs, we compare against the retained set and resolve it against the production record. This is why we insist on sealed retained units from every run.
